        public static IGeometry GetExample1()
        {
            //TriangleStrip: Square Lying On XY Plane

            IGeometryCollection multiPatchGeometryCollection = new MultiPatchClass();

            IPointCollection triangleStripPointCollection = new TriangleStripClass();

            triangleStripP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-6, -6, 0), ref _missing, ref _missing);
            triangleStripP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-6, 6, 0), ref _missing, ref _missing);
            triangleStripP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(6, -6, 0), ref _missing, ref _missing);
            triangleStripP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(6, 6, 0), ref _missing, ref _missing);

            multiPatchGeometryCollection.AddGeometry(triangleStripPointCollection as IGeometry, ref _missing, ref _missing);

            return(multiPatchGeometryCollection as IGeometry);
        }

        public static IGeometry GetExample3()
        {
            //Composite: House Composed Of 7 Ring, 1 TriangleStrip, And 1 Triangles Parts

            IGeometryCollection multiPatchGeometryCollection = new MultiPatchClass();

            IMultiPatch multiPatch = multiPatchGeometryCollection as IMultiPatch;

            //Base (Exterior Ring)

            IPointCollection basePointCollection = new RingClass();
            basePoint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, 4, 0), ref _missing, ref _missing);
            basePoint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-5, 4, 0), ref _missing, ref _missing);
            basePoint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-5, -4, 0), ref _missing, ref _missing);
            basePoint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, -4, 0), ref _missing, ref _missing);
            basePointCollection.AddPoint(basePointCollection.get_Point(0), ref _missing, ref _missing);

            multiPatchGeometryCollection.AddGeometry(basePointCollection as IGeometry, ref _missing, ref _missing);

            multiPatch.PutRingType(basePointCollection as IRing, esriMultiPatchRingType.esriMultiPatchOuterRing);

            //Front With Cutaway For Door (Exterior Ring)

            IPointCollection frontPointCollection = new RingClass();
            frontP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, 4, 6), ref _missing, ref _missing);
            frontP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, 4, 0), ref _missing, ref _missing);
            frontP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, 1, 0), ref _missing, ref _missing);
            frontP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, 1, 4), ref _missing, ref _missing);
            frontP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, -1, 4), ref _missing, ref _missing);
            frontP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, -1, 0), ref _missing, ref _missing);
            frontP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, -4, 0), ref _missing, ref _missing);
            frontP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, -4, 6), ref _missing, ref _missing);
            frontPointCollection.AddPoint(frontPointCollection.get_Point(0), ref _missing, ref _missing);

            multiPatchGeometryCollection.AddGeometry(frontPointCollection as IGeometry, ref _missing, ref _missing);

            multiPatch.PutRingType(frontPointCollection as IRing, esriMultiPatchRingType.esriMultiPatchOuterRing);

            //Back (Exterior Ring)

            IPointCollection backPointCollection = new RingClass();
            backP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-5, 4, 6), ref _missing, ref _missing);
            backP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-5, -4, 6), ref _missing, ref _missing);
            backP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-5, -4, 0), ref _missing, ref _missing);
            backP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-5, 4, 0), ref _missing, ref _missing);
            backPointCollection.AddPoint(backPointCollection.get_Point(0), ref _missing, ref _missing);

            multiPatchGeometryCollection.AddGeometry(backPointCollection as IGeometry, ref _missing, ref _missing);

            multiPatch.PutRingType(backPointCollection as IRing, esriMultiPatchRingType.esriMultiPatchOuterRing);

            //Right Side (Ring Group)

            //Exterior Ring

            IPointCollection rightSideExteriorPointCollection = new RingClass();
            rightSideExteriorP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, 4, 6), ref _missing, ref _missing);
            rightSideExteriorP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-5, 4, 6), ref _missing, ref _missing);
            rightSideExteriorP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-5, 4, 0), ref _missing, ref _missing);
            rightSideExteriorP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, 4, 0), ref _missing, ref _missing);
            rightSideExteriorPointCollection.AddPoint(rightSideExteriorPointCollection.get_Point(0), ref _missing, ref _missing);

            multiPatchGeometryCollection.AddGeometry(rightSideExteriorPointCollection as IGeometry, ref _missing, ref _missing);

            multiPatch.PutRingType(rightSideExteriorPointCollection as IRing, esriMultiPatchRingType.esriMultiPatchOuterRing);

            //Interior Ring

            IPointCollection rightSideInteriorPointCollection = new RingClass();
            rightSideInteriorP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(1, 4, 4), ref _missing, ref _missing);
            rightSideInteriorP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(1, 4, 2), ref _missing, ref _missing);
            rightSideInteriorP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-1, 4, 2), ref _missing, ref _missing);
            rightSideInteriorP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-1, 4, 4), ref _missing, ref _missing);
            rightSideInteriorPointCollection.AddPoint(rightSideInteriorPointCollection.get_Point(0), ref _missing, ref _missing);

            multiPatchGeometryCollection.AddGeometry(rightSideInteriorPointCollection as IGeometry, ref _missing, ref _missing);

            multiPatch.PutRingType(rightSideInteriorPointCollection as IRing, esriMultiPatchRingType.esriMultiPatchInnerRing);

            //Left Side (Ring Group)

            //Exterior Ring

            IPointCollection leftSideExteriorPointCollection = new RingClass();
            leftSideExteriorP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, -4, 6), ref _missing, ref _missing);
            leftSideExteriorP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, -4, 0), ref _missing, ref _missing);
            leftSideExteriorP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-5, -4, 0), ref _missing, ref _missing);
            leftSideExteriorP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-5, -4, 6), ref _missing, ref _missing);
            leftSideExteriorPointCollection.AddPoint(leftSideExteriorPointCollection.get_Point(0), ref _missing, ref _missing);

            multiPatchGeometryCollection.AddGeometry(leftSideExteriorPointCollection as IGeometry, ref _missing, ref _missing);

            multiPatch.PutRingType(leftSideExteriorPointCollection as IRing, esriMultiPatchRingType.esriMultiPatchOuterRing);

            //Interior Ring

            IPointCollection leftSideInteriorPointCollection = new RingClass();
            leftSideInteriorP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(1, -4, 4), ref _missing, ref _missing);
            leftSideInteriorP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-1, -4, 4), ref _missing, ref _missing);
            leftSideInteriorP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-1, -4, 2), ref _missing, ref _missing);
            leftSideInteriorP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(1, -4, 2), ref _missing, ref _missing);
            leftSideInteriorPointCollection.AddPoint(leftSideInteriorPointCollection.get_Point(0), ref _missing, ref _missing);

            multiPatchGeometryCollection.AddGeometry(leftSideInteriorPointCollection as IGeometry, ref _missing, ref _missing);

            multiPatch.PutRingType(leftSideInteriorPointCollection as IRing, esriMultiPatchRingType.esriMultiPatchInnerRing);

            //Roof

            IPointCollection roofPointCollection = new TriangleStripClass();
            roofP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-5, 4, 6), ref _missing, ref _missing);
            roofP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, 4, 6), ref _missing, ref _missing);
            roofP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-5, 0, 9), ref _missing, ref _missing);
            roofP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, 0, 9), ref _missing, ref _missing);
            roofP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-5, -4, 6), ref _missing, ref _missing);
            roofP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, -4, 6), ref _missing, ref _missing);

            multiPatchGeometryCollection.AddGeometry(roofPointCollection as IGeometry, ref _missing, ref _missing);

            //Triangular Area Between Roof And Front/Back

            IPointCollection triangularAreaPointCollection = new TrianglesClass();

            //Area Between Roof And Front

            triangularAreaP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, 0, 9), ref _missing, ref _missing);
            triangularAreaP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, 4, 6), ref _missing, ref _missing);
            triangularAreaP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(5, -4, 6), ref _missing, ref _missing);

            //Area Between Roof And Back

            triangularAreaP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-5, 0, 9), ref _missing, ref _missing);
            triangularAreaP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-5, -4, 6), ref _missing, ref _missing);
            triangularAreaPointCollection.AddPoint(GeometryUtilities.ConstructPoint3D(-5, 4, 6), ref _missing, ref _missing);

            multiPatchGeometryCollection.AddGeometry(triangularAreaPointCollection as IGeometry, ref _missing, ref _missing);

            return multiPatchGeometryCollection as IGeometry;
        }

        public static IGeometry GetExample5()
        {
            const double CylinderBaseDegrees = 360.0;
            const int CylinderBaseDivisions = 8;
            const double VectorComponentOffset = 0.0000001;
            const double CylinderBaseRadius = 3;
            const double CylinderUpperZ = 8;
            const double CylinderLowerZ = 0;

            //Vector3D: Cylinder, TriangleStrip With 8 Vertices

            IGeometryCollection multiPatchGeometryCollection = new MultiPatchClass();

            IPointCollection triangleStripPointCollection = new TriangleStripClass();

            //Set Cylinder Base Origin To (0, 0, 0)

            IPoint originPoint = GeometryUtilities.ConstructPoint3D(0, 0, 0);

            //Define Upper Portion Of Axis Around Which Vector Should Be Rotated To Generate Cylinder Base Vertices

            IVector3D upperAxisVector3D = GeometryUtilities.ConstructVector3D(0, 0, 10);

            //Define Lower Portion of Axis Around Which Vector Should Be Rotated To Generate Cylinder Base Vertices

            IVector3D lowerAxisVector3D = GeometryUtilities.ConstructVector3D(0, 0, -10);

            //Add A Slight Offset To X or Y Component Of One Of Axis Vectors So Cross Product Does Not Return A Zero-Length Vector

            lowerAxisVector3D.XComponent += VectorComponentOffset;

            //Obtain Cross Product Of Upper And Lower Axis Vectors To Obtain Normal Vector To Axis Of Rotation To Generate Cylinder Base Vertices

            IVector3D normalVector3D = upperAxisVector3D.CrossProduct(lowerAxisVector3D) as IVector3D;

            //Set Normal Vector Magnitude Equal To Radius Of Cylinder Base

            normalVector3D.Magnitude = CylinderBaseRadius;

            //Obtain Angle Of Rotation In Radians As Function Of Number Of Divisions Within 360 Degree Sweep Of Cylinder Base

            double rotationAngleInRadians = GeometryUtilities.GetRadians(CylinderBaseDegrees / CylinderBaseDivisions);

            for (int i = 0; i < CylinderBaseDivisions; i++)
            {
                //Rotate Normal Vector Specified Rotation Angle In Radians Around Either Upper Or Lower Axis

                normalVector3D.Rotate(rotationAngleInRadians, upperAxisVector3D);

                //Construct Cylinder Base Vertex Whose XY Coordinates Are The Sum Of Origin XY Coordinates And Normal Vector XY Components

                IPoint vertexPoint = GeometryUtilities.ConstructPoint3D(originPoint.X + normalVector3D.XComponent,
                                                                      originPoint.Y + normalVector3D.YComponent,
                                                                      0);

                //Construct Lower Base Vertex From This Point And Add To TriangleStrip

                IPoint lowerVertexPoint = GeometryUtilities.ConstructPoint3D(vertexPoint.X, vertexPoint.Y, CylinderLowerZ);

                triangleStripPointCollection.AddPoint(lowerVertexPoint, ref _missing, ref _missing);

                //Construct Upper Base Vertex From This Point And Add To TriangleStrip

                IPoint upperVertexPoint = GeometryUtilities.ConstructPoint3D(vertexPoint.X, vertexPoint.Y, CylinderUpperZ);

                triangleStripPointCollection.AddPoint(upperVertexPoint, ref _missing, ref _missing);
            }

            //Re-Add The First And Second Points Of The Triangle Strip (First Two Vertices Added) To Close The Strip

            triangleStripPointCollection.AddPoint(triangleStripPointCollection.get_Point(0), ref _missing, ref _missing);

            triangleStripPointCollection.AddPoint(triangleStripPointCollection.get_Point(1), ref _missing, ref _missing);

            //Add TriangleStrip To MultiPatch

            multiPatchGeometryCollection.AddGeometry(triangleStripPointCollection as IGeometry, ref _missing, ref _missing);

            return multiPatchGeometryCollection as IGeometry;
        }

        public IGeometry CreateSphere(IPoint centerPoint, double radius, double minLon = 0.0, double maxLon = 360.0, double minLat = -90.0, double maxLat = 90.0, double stepAngle = 18.0, bool bSmooth = false, bool bFlipS = false, bool bFlipT = false)
        {
            IMultiPatch         patch = new MultiPatchClass();
            IGeometryCollection pGCol = patch as IGeometryCollection;
            IGeometry2          pGeom;
            IPoint              pt;
            IPointCollection    pStrip;
            IVector3D           pVector  = new Vector3DClass();
            IEncode3DProperties pGE      = new GeometryEnvironmentClass();
            double              xStep    = (maxLon - minLon) / stepAngle;
            double              yStep    = (maxLat - minLat) / (stepAngle / 2.0);
            double              lonRange = maxLon - minLon;
            double              latRange = maxLat - minLat;
            object              missing  = Type.Missing;
            double              lon      = minLon;

            while (lon < maxLon)
            {
                pStrip = new TriangleStripClass();
                double lat = minLat;
                while (lat < maxLat)
                {
                    double azi = DegreesToRadians(lon);
                    double inc = DegreesToRadians(lat);
                    pVector.PolarSet(-azi, inc, radius);
                    pt   = new PointClass();
                    pt.X = centerPoint.X + pVector.XComponent;
                    pt.Y = centerPoint.Y + pVector.YComponent;
                    pt.Z = centerPoint.Z + pVector.ZComponent;
                    double s = (lon - minLon) / lonRange;
                    if (bFlipS)
                    {
                        s = 1 + (s * -1);
                    }
                    if (s <= 0)
                    {
                        s = 0.001;
                    }
                    else if (s >= 1)
                    {
                        s = 0.999;
                    }

                    double t = (maxLat - lat) / latRange;
                    if (bFlipT)
                    {
                        t = 1 + (t * -1);
                    }
                    if (t <= 0)
                    {
                        t = 0.001;
                    }
                    else if (t >= 1)
                    {
                        t = 0.999;
                    }

                    double m = 0.0;
                    pGE.PackTexture2D(s, t, out m);
                    if (bSmooth)
                    {
                        pVector.Normalize();
                        pGE.PackNormal(pVector, out m);
                    }
                    pt.M = m;

                    pStrip.AddPoint(pt, ref missing, ref missing);
                    if ((lat != -90) && (lat != 90))
                    {
                        azi = (lon + xStep) * Math.PI / 180.00;
                        inc = lat * Math.PI / 180.00;
                        pVector.PolarSet(-azi, inc, radius);
                        pt   = new PointClass();
                        pt.X = centerPoint.X + pVector.XComponent;
                        pt.Y = centerPoint.Y + pVector.YComponent;
                        pt.Z = centerPoint.Z + pVector.ZComponent;
                        s    = (lon + xStep - minLon) / lonRange;
                        if (bFlipS)
                        {
                            s = 1 + (s * -1);
                        }
                        if (s <= 0)
                        {
                            s = 0.001;
                        }
                        else if (s >= 1)
                        {
                            s = 0.999;
                        }

                        t = (maxLat - lat) / latRange;
                        if (bFlipT)
                        {
                            t = 1 + (t * -1);
                        }
                        if (t <= 0)
                        {
                            t = 0.001;
                        }
                        else if (t >= 1)
                        {
                            t = 0.999;
                        }

                        m = 0.0;
                        pGE.PackTexture2D(s, t, out m);
                        if (bSmooth)
                        {
                            pVector.Normalize();
                            pGE.PackNormal(pVector, out m);
                        }
                        pt.M = m;

                        pStrip.AddPoint(pt, ref missing, ref missing);
                    }
                    lat = lat + yStep;
                }
                pGeom = pStrip as IGeometry2;
                pGCol.AddGeometry(pGeom, ref missing, ref missing);
                lon = lon + xStep;
            }

            IMAware pMAware = patch as IMAware;

            pMAware.MAware = true;
            return(patch);
        }
